Lakeview Cemetery
12316 Euclid Avenue
Cleveland Heights, OH
Tour is from 10:00am to 12:00 noon. Meet inside the
cemetery at the Garfield monument. Founded in
1869, Lake View Cemetery sits on 285 acres of land
and was modeled after the great garden cemeteries
of Victorian England and France. There is so much to
see at Lakeview that it deserves multiple visits
throughout the year. This fall visit should offer
stunning color and maybe some Prunus autumnalis
in bloom. In addition to the horticulture wonders is the
President Garfield Monument and Wade Chapel with
Tiffany glass window and murals. Many famous folks
are interred there... How many names you recognize?
